Focal points for Research & Development during the life cycle of a project are as follows: Idea Phase. At Barnhart, we are continuous looking for ways to Improve and grow to be the best in our industry. Many ideas will come from field personnel, project managers, sales personnel, Senior Leadership, operators, etc. It's the job of the R&D team to research the viability of the ideas and determine if the ideas should be pursued. Concept Phase. Gather information and begin to establish design parameters. Preliminary CAD Models and calculations may need to be created along with an initial cost estimate for the project. Development Phase. The concept is further developed into a workable solution with detailed calculations to validate the agreed upon design parameters and assumptions in the development phase. CAD models are finalized, and fabrication drawings are created and reviewed during this phase. Production Phase. The design team will be directly involved and stay in close communication with the Fabrication Services Department while the gear is being built. Load testing is often performed on specialty rigging tools at the direction of Engineering. Implementation Phase. Detailed specification sheets, operation & maintenance manuals, automation calculators and other various support files & documents are finalized during implementation. An R&D Engineer may be present during the initial field use of the gear to capture lessons learned and incorporate improvements into design revisions. Responsibilities may include the following and other duties may be assigned. -Designs, develops, and tests a wide variety of containers used for the protection, display, and handling of products. -Determines packaging specifications according to the nature of the product, cost limitations, legal requirements, and the type of protection required, considering need for resistance to such external variables as moisture, corrosive chemicals, temperature variations, light, heat, rough handling, and tampering. -Designs package exteriors considering such factors as product identification, Operating Room Workflow, aesthetic quality, printing and production techniques. -Responsibilities may include documentation management and/or coordination of Good Manufacturing Practices (GMPs), and may support prototype line development in manufacturing facilities/plants. How much does a Manufacturing Engineer earn in Olive Branch, MS?

The average manufacturing engineer in Olive Branch, MS earns between $50,000 and $79,000 annually. This compares to the national average manufacturing engineer range of $60,000 to $102,000.

Average Manufacturing Engineer Salary In Olive Branch, MS

$63,000
